如何在Spring Boot中引入Swagger

1. 流程概述

在Spring Boot项目中引入Swagger主要分为以下几个步骤:

步骤 描述
1 添加Swagger依赖
2 配置Swagger
3 创建Swagger配置类
4 启动项目
5 访问Swagger页面

2. 具体步骤及代码示例

步骤1:添加Swagger依赖

pom.xml文件中添加Swagger的依赖:

<dependency>
    <groupId>io.springfox</groupId>
    <artifactId>springfox-boot-starter</artifactId>
    <version>3.0.0</version>
</dependency>

步骤2:配置Swagger

在Spring Boot的配置文件中添加Swagger的配置,一般为application.propertiesapplication.yml

springfox.documentation.swagger-ui.enabled=true

步骤3:创建Swagger配置类

创建一个Swagger配置类,用于配置Swagger的信息:

@Configuration
@EnableSwagger2
public class SwaggerConfig {
    
    @Bean
    public Docket api() {
        return new Docket(DocumentationType.SWAGGER_2)
            .select()
            .apis(RequestHandlerSelectors.basePackage("com.example.controller"))
            .paths(PathSelectors.any())
            .build();
    }
}

步骤4:启动项目

启动Spring Boot项目,Swagger会自动扫描你的API并生成文档。

步骤5:访问Swagger页面

在浏览器中输入http://localhost:8080/swagger-ui/index.html即可访问Swagger页面,查看API文档。

3. 总结

通过以上步骤,你已经成功在Spring Boot项目中引入了Swagger,并且可以通过Swagger页面查看API文档。Swagger是一个非常方便的API文档工具,能够帮助开发者快速了解和测试API接口,提高开发效率。希望你能够继续学习和掌握更多技术知识,不断提升自己的技术水平。祝你在编程的道路上越走越远!